shell 脚本编辑之hello word

学语言大家都习惯于从Hello World开始,我们也不脱俗,费话少说,直接上代码:

1#!/bin/bash

2

3#Thisiscomment

4

5str="HelloWorld"

6echo$str

7

8exit0

下面来逐行解释:

shell 脚本第一行必须使用#!/bin/bash(或其它的如#!/bin/sh等开头)

#开头是注释,注释直到行尾

第5行str="HelloWorld", 是变量赋值,结果就是变量str的值是"HelloWorld"

echo是内部命令 如果没有重定向则将变量输出到屏幕,$str是取得变量str的值

exit0 是设置退出状态

将上面的代码保存为hello.sh(不要行号)。现在这个文件还没执行权限,我们需要给它执行权限,chmodu+xhello.sh;接着就可以执行这个脚本了,使用如下命令:

[root@rock~]#./hello.sh

HelloWorld

我们第一脚本就完成了。

相关推荐